What Are the Most Common Problems Encountered During Laravel Upgrades?

Laravel upgrades frequently trigger compatibility errors, migration failures, deprecated feature breaks, frontend build misalignments, and PHP version mismatches. Identifying these issues early is key to preventing downtime and accumulating technical debt.

Which Composer Dependency Conflicts Cause Upgrade Failures?

Close-up of a computer screen displaying Composer commands for managing Laravel project dependencies

Composer dependency conflicts arise when package version requirements clash with the new Laravel release. These conflicts typically manifest as unmet dependencies or version overlaps. For instance, an older authentication package might mandate Laravel 8, while your core application requires Laravel 12. Resolving these issues involves carefully examining your constraints and aligning package versions.

How Do Database Migration Errors Impact Laravel Upgrades?

Database migration errors can bring the upgrade process to a standstill, either by failing to apply schema changes or by preventing proper rollbacks. Common problems include missing foreign key constraints, incompatible column types, and potential data loss. When a migration fails without a robust rollback strategy, it can jeopardize your production data. Planning pre-upgrade backups and staging migrations significantly mitigates this risk.

What Breaking Changes and Deprecated Features Affect Laravel Versions?

Laravel frequently deprecates methods or restructures core components between major versions. Examples include the removal of helper functions, renaming of middleware, or changes in event dispatch signatures. If your legacy code relies on these deprecated APIs, it will likely break at runtime. Refactoring outdated calls and consulting the official upgrade guides are essential for ensuring compatibility.

How Do Frontend Tech Stack Transitions Create Upgrade Challenges?

Migrating from Laravel Mix and Webpack to Vite introduces significant differences in asset compilation, module resolution, and plugin configurations. Projects utilizing Vue 2 or older React setups might experience broken hot module replacement or missing polyfills. Updating your build scripts and adapter plugins is crucial to align your frontend pipeline with Laravel 12 conventions.

Why Is PHP Version Compatibility Critical for Laravel Upgrades?

Laravel 12 requires PHP 8.2 or higher to leverage advanced syntax, attributes, and performance enhancements. Running on an unsupported PHP version will lead to fatal errors. Ensuring your server environment meets the PHP requirement and updating PHP-FPM or OPCache parameters is a critical prerequisite before initiating the Laravel update.

What Are Best Practices to Prevent and Fix Database Migration Failures?

Team collaborating on a database schema diagram to plan for a smooth Laravel migration

Proactive migration planning, rigorous schema version control, and well-defined rollback strategies are essential for preventing disruptions during Laravel updates. A disciplined approach ensures data integrity and facilitates seamless schema evolution.

How to Plan and Backup Database Schema Before Upgrading Laravel?

Before initiating any migrations, it’s crucial to export a complete database dump and archive it securely offsite. Utilize tools like for consistent snapshots or leverage Laravel’s native backup packages. Document your existing schema thoroughly and verify your backups by restoring them to a staging environment. Preparing Entity-Relationship Diagrams (ERDs) of your table relationships will help anticipate potential foreign key constraints.

What Are Common Foreign Key and Data Integrity Issues During Migration?

Errors such as often arise from mismatched column types or missing indexed parent keys. Similarly, attempting to insert null values into non-nullable columns will break migrations. Validating column definitions against your migration blueprint and adding default values or nullable modifiers are effective ways to resolve these conflicts.

How to Address Breaking Changes and Deprecated Features in Laravel Upgrades?

Identifying deprecated functions and refactoring legacy code is paramount as core framework APIs evolve. A systematic audit ensures that no outdated code remains in your application.

What Are Key Deprecated Features from Laravel 5.x to 12?

Across Laravel versions from 5.x to 12, numerous changes have occurred. Helper functions like and have been removed, route middleware syntax has shifted, and event listeners now require explicit type hints. Authentication scaffolding has transitioned from being built-in to utilizing starter kits. Recognizing each of these changes is crucial to prevent runtime errors.

How to Identify and Refactor Legacy Code for Compatibility?

Static analysis tools such as Rector PHP and PHPStan can efficiently scan your codebase for deprecated method calls and type inconsistencies. Once identified, refactor calls to utilize the new methods, update middleware definitions, and replace outdated helper usages with their corresponding facade or class-based equivalents.

How Do Frontend Technology Changes Affect Laravel Upgrade Success?

Modernizing your frontend build tools and JavaScript frameworks is an integral part of a comprehensive Laravel upgrade. Adjustments to your asset pipeline can profoundly influence your application’s stability and your development team’s workflow.

What Issues Arise When Migrating from Webpack Mix to Vite?

Webpack Mix configurations often embed versioning, plugins, and asset pipelines specific to Webpack. Transitioning to Vite necessitates rewriting build scripts, adjusting asset import paths, and installing Vite-specific plugins. Without updating asset references, compiled files may fail to load, or hot module replacement might cease to function.

How to Handle Vue 2 to Vue 3 or React Integration During Upgrades?

Upgrading Vue 2 projects to Vue 3 involves replacing deprecated lifecycle hooks, updating component API syntax, and integrating the composition API plugin. For React integration, ensure your Babel and ESLint configurations properly support JSX and React 18 features. Installing official adapter packages will align your JavaScript framework with Laravel’s approach to server-side rendering and client components.

What Are Recommended Strategies for Frontend Refactoring in Laravel 12?

Begin with a stepwise upgrade of minor versions, meticulously testing asset compilation at each stage. Maintain parallel configurations to allow for fallback if Vite migrations introduce issues. Leverage Laravel’s official Vite plugin for asset versioning and enable Fast Refresh. This iterative approach ensures your frontend pipeline remains functional throughout the entire upgrade process.

What Security Vulnerabilities Must Be Addressed During Laravel Upgrades?

Security vulnerabilities often emerge when older Laravel versions expose known Common Vulnerabilities and Exposures (CVEs). Incorporating patches and maintaining continuous monitoring are crucial for protecting your applications and data integrity.

How Do Recent CVEs Like CVE-2024-52301 Impact Laravel Applications?

, for instance, permitted the unauthorized execution of certain chained requests in Laravel versions up to 11.30.9. Applications that have not upgraded to 11.31.0 remain susceptible to privilege escalation. Remediating this CVE requires updating the framework and implementing robust middleware integrity checks.

What Proactive Strategies Ensure a Smooth and Successful Laravel Upgrade?

A proactive upgrade readiness assessment, incremental version updates, and strategic performance optimization are key to reducing risks and streamlining your migration process.

How to Conduct a Laravel Upgrade Readiness Assessment?

Begin by conducting a thorough audit of your current dependencies, PHP version, and the complexity of your custom code. Utilize static analysis tools to gauge compatibility, map out deprecated features, and estimate the required refactoring effort. This assessment will provide a clear roadmap, including estimated timelines, necessary resources, and potential impacts.

Why Are Incremental Upgrades and Robust Testing Essential?

Upgrading one minor version at a time significantly reduces complexity and allows for the rapid isolation of any issues that arise. Comprehensive unit, integration, and browser tests are vital for validating core functionality after each incremental step. This methodical approach ensures the early detection of regressions and facilitates smoother rollbacks if necessary.
